Output 75399138b3e544f22c72d60063ce7b66cc5c8b1b687fcd0b35c8b02ebed556c6:5

value
61024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7944b23e8464973271fc8651c28fcef2bd7fdf5a OP_EQUAL
address
3CkDyraAsugME335xTQDpK82RS8rYu9U7P
transaction
75399138b3e544f22c72d60063ce7b66cc5c8b1b687fcd0b35c8b02ebed556c6
confirmations
68
spent
true